The Flag of France

With the exception of the period from 1815 to 1830, during the restoration of the Bourbon Dynasty following the final defeat of Napoleon, when the official flag of the restored French kingdom was a simple white field, the blue, white, and red tricolor flag has remained the flag of France since 1789 forward.
